Unfortunately, scowl includes over 700 abbreviations (even after ignoring the ones in all caps which are acronyms). None of them have an ending period that in any way would indicate that the word is abbreviated.

I have attached the list.

The problem is people have started dropping the "." from the most common abbreviations like cm, mm, ft, in, Mrs, Mr, Dr, PhD, etc which just confuses things even more.

I have attached the list of over 700 abbreviations that should probably either have an ending period added or be removed as they hide common spelling errors and end up polluting suggestions with nonsense.

Feedback welcome as to how best to treat these "words".
